Default HELP me w/Speed-Dependant volume!! CR-210

My '99 C2 has the CR-210 tape deck with 6 disc changer. As you all know the stereo sounds horrible anyway but it works for now. The thing that really annoys me is the speed-dependant volume! I can hear it get louder around 40 then at 60 or so and it bugs me. If it was a gradual increase it wouldnt bug me but it is very noticable and abrupt. I looked through the manual and searched online and have found nothing on how to disable this feature! The manual only shows how to do it with the HiFi stereo. Please Please Please help me out!

From the 210 manual:

To access the User Menu, turn on the radio and immediately press and hold the multifunction key ("*") for more than 2 seconds. The User Menu can only be accessed within the first 8 seconds of operation. The display shows "SEL USER". Use the automatic switch (right side vertical rocker) to choose the function you want to adjust. If no choice is made within 4 seconds, the radio returns to the last operating mode.

Adjustment of Speed Dependent Volume Control (GAL)
When the radio is in the "User Menu", use the automatic switch until "GAL" appears in the display. Use the multifunction keys under the "< >" symbols to choose the level desired ("GAL OFF", "GAL 1", "GAL 2", or "GAL 3", in increasing sensitivity to road speed). To store your choice, press the multifunction key under "AS".

Press the automatic switch to select "END" in the display. After four seconds, the "User Menu" is left and the last radio function returns.
